A Villanelle for Graeme Worthy, On the Occasion of the Thirtieth Anniversary of His Birth.

A man more worthy there has never been
Than Graeme, magnificent and noble friend!
A gentleman without; a sage within.

At what superlative shall I begin?
Such majesty is hard to comprehend -
A man more worthy there has never been.

He cycles free and tall on bike tires thin
What earthly boundary does he not transcend?
A gentleman without; a sage within.

Our modern pitfalls earn his deep chagrin -
He scoffs as we fall for each TV trend.
A man more worthy there has never been.

Hemingway's whiskers live upon his chin:
A kingly countenance to apprehend.
A gentleman without; a sage within.

He plays my heartstrings like a violin,
Such affection to him do I extend.
A man more worthy there has never been.
A gentleman without; a sage within.
